import irc.bot
import sleekxmpp
import threading
import smtplib
import requests
import ssl
class Notifier(object):
def send_notification(self, message):
raise NotImplementedError()
def terminate(self):
pass
class Print(Notifier):
"""
Prints to terminal where aammonit is run
"""
def send_notification(self, message):
print(message)
class Pushover(Notifier):
"""
Simple https://pushover.net/ notifier, needs user key and application token.
"""
def __init__(self, token, user):
self.token = token
self.user = user
def send_notification(self, message):
API_URL = "https://api.pushover.net/1/messages.json"
data = {"token": self.token,
"user": self.user,
"message": message,
}
try:
requests.post(API_URL, data=data)
except Exception as e:
print("Pushover notification failed: {0}".format(str(e)))
class Irc(Notifier, threading.Thread):
"""
IRC bot notifier. if "target" is a channel, he will join the channel on connect.
"""
def __init__(self, server, port, nickname, target, nickserv_pass=None, ssl=False):
self.server = server
self.port = port
self.ssl = ssl
self.nickname = nickname
self.target = target
self.nickserv_pass = nickserv_pass
threading.Thread.__init__(self)
self.start()
def run(self):
self.bot = self.IrcBot(self.server, self.port, self.nickname, self.target, self.nickserv_pass, self.ssl)
self.bot.start()
def terminate(self):
if self.bot.running:
self.bot.running = False
self.bot.connection.quit()
def send_notification(self, message):
if self.bot.running:
self.bot.connection.privmsg(self.target, message)
class IrcBot(irc.bot.SingleServerIRCBot):
def __init__(self, server, port, nickname, target, nickserv_pass, use_ssl=False):
self.server = server
self.port = port
self.use_ssl = use_ssl
self.nickname = nickname
self.target = target
self.nickserv_pass = nickserv_pass
self.running = False
if self.use_ssl:
ssl_factory = irc.connection.Factory(wrapper=ssl.wrap_socket)
irc.bot.SingleServerIRCBot.__init__(self, [(server, port)], nickname, nickname, connect_factory=ssl_factory)
else:
irc.bot.SingleServerIRCBot.__init__(self, [(server, port)], nickname, nickname)
def on_welcome(self, connection, event):
if self.nickserv_pass:
self.connection.privmsg("Nickserv", "identify " + self.nickserv_pass)
if irc.client.is_channel(self.target):
connection.join(self.target)
self.running = True
def on_disconnect(self, connection, event):
self.running = False
raise SystemExit()
class Xmpp(Notifier, sleekxmpp.ClientXMPP):
"""
XMPP notifier, needs dnspython to auto-resolve the host. You may also manually specify it.
"""
def __init__(self, jid, password, recipient, host=None, tls=True, ssl=False, port=5222):
self.recipient = recipient
sleekxmpp.ClientXMPP.__init__(self, jid, password)
self.add_event_handler("session_start", self.start)
self.use_signals(signals=['SIGHUP', 'SIGTERM', 'SIGINT'])
address = (host, port) if host else None
if self.connect(address=address, use_tls=tls, use_ssl=ssl):
self.send_notification("XMPP notifier online.")
self.process()
else:
raise Exception("Could not connect")
def terminate(self):
self.send_notification("XMPP notifier going offline.")
self.disconnect(wait=True)
def start(self, event):
self.send_presence()
self.get_roster()
self.register_plugin('xep_0030') # Service Discovery
self.register_plugin('xep_0199') # XMPP Ping
def send_notification(self, message):
self.send_message(mto=self.recipient, mbody=message, mtype='chat')
class Email(Notifier):
def __init__(self, recipient, sender=None, server="localhost", port=25, username=None, password=None, ssl=False, starttls=False):
self.recipient = recipient
self.sender = sender if sender else username
self.server = server
self.port = port
self.username = username
self.password = password
self.ssl = ssl
self.starttls = starttls
def send_notification(self, message):
try:
if self.ssl:
srv = smtplib.SMTP_SSL(self.server, self.port)
else:
srv = smtplib.SMTP(self.server, self.port)
srv.ehlo()
if self.starttls:
srv.starttls()
srv.ehlo()
if self.username:
srv.login(self.username, self.password)
message = """From: {0}
To: {1}
Subject: aammonit notification
{2}
""".format(self.sender, self.recipient, message)
srv.sendmail(self.sender, [self.recipient], message)
srv.quit()
except Exception as e:
print("Email notification failed: {0}".format(str(e)))
